A Closer Look at the Water Bike Adventure

What to Expect During the Tour
This two-hour water biking experience begins at 1 SW 1st Pl in Crystal River. After arriving about 30 minutes early, you’ll watch a brief safety and informational video from the Florida Fish and Wildlife Conservation Commission (FWC). Then, you’ll sign waivers—standard procedure but worth noting if you’re traveling with young children or have special needs.
Once on the water, you’ll find the hydrobikes extremely stable—designed to hold up to 250 pounds—and surprisingly easy to paddle. Whether you’re a seasoned cyclist or new to water sports, you’ll appreciate how intuitive these bikes are. The adjustable seats accommodate different heights, and children aged 3-7 can ride with an adult on a pontoon for free—a thoughtful touch for families.

Practical Details
The rental includes the water bike, a life vest, and a map of the area to help navigate and identify points of interest. The activity is best suited for most travelers, including those with service animals. Parking fees are $10 per booking, and there’s a $5 launch fee per person to keep in mind.
Booking and Cancellation Policies
Reservations are often made well in advance, averaging 65 days ahead, indicating high demand. Cancellations are free if made at least 24 hours before the scheduled start—giving you peace of mind if your plans change. If weather conditions turn poor, your booking can be rescheduled or refunded, making this a low-risk activity.

FAQ

How long is the water bike tour?
The tour lasts approximately 2 hours, including time for safety briefings and getting on the water.
What is included in the rental?
Your rental includes the water bike, a life vest, and a map of the area.
Can children participate?
Yes, children aged 8 and up can ride independently. Children aged 3-7 can ride on a pontoon with a paying adult for free.
What about parking?
Parking fees are $10 per booking, payable at the location.
Is the activity suitable for all ages?
Yes, it’s suitable for ages 8 to 80, thanks to the stability and adjustable seats of the bikes.
What’s the cancellation policy?
You can cancel for free up to 24 hours before your scheduled start—a full refund is available if canceled early.
What if the weather is bad?
If the weather turns poor, your reservation will be canceled, and you’ll be offered a different date or a full refund.
Do I need prior experience?
No prior experience is necessary. The bikes are easy to paddle and handle.
How far in advance should I book?
Most bookings are made about 65 days ahead, so early planning is recommended, especially in peak season.
Are there any additional costs?
Yes, there’s a $5 launch fee per person, and parking fees apply unless you find free parking nearby.
